def _get_allowed_hostclass(self, project_name):
"""Get the allowed list of hostclass from configuration."""
try:
group = CONF[project_name]
except cfg.NoSuchOptError:
# dynamically add the group into the configuration
group = cfg.OptGroup(project_name, 'project options')
CONF.register_group(group)
CONF.register_opt(cfg.ListOpt('allowed_classes'),
group=project_name)
try:
allowed_classes = CONF[project_name].allowed_classes
except cfg.NoSuchOptError:
LOG.error('No allowed_classes config option in [%s]', project_name)
return []
else:
if allowed_classes:
return allowed_classes
else:
return []

def filter_images(self):
"""Filter which images to build."""
filter_ = list()
if self.regex:
filter_ += self.regex
elif self.conf.profile:
for profile in self.conf.profile:
if profile not in self.conf.profiles:
self.conf.register_opt(cfg.ListOpt(profile,
default=[]),
'profiles')
if len(self.conf.profiles[profile]) == 0:
msg = 'Profile: {} does not exist'.format(profile)
raise ValueError(msg)
else:
filter_ += self.conf.profiles[profile]
if filter_:
patterns = re.compile(r"|".join(filter_).join('()'))
for image in self.images:
if image.status in (STATUS_MATCHED, STATUS_SKIPPED):
continue
if re.search(patterns, image.name):
image.status = STATUS_MATCHED
while (image.parent is not None and
image.parent.status not in (STATUS_MATCHED,
STATUS_SKIPPED)):
image = image.parent
if self.conf.skip_parents:
image.status = STATUS_SKIPPED
elif (self.conf.skip_existing and
image.in_docker_cache()):
image.status = STATUS_SKIPPED
else:
image.status = STATUS_MATCHED
LOG.debug('Image %s matched regex', image.name)
else:
image.status = STATUS_UNMATCHED
else:
for image in self.images:
image.status = STATUS_MATCHED
